before you guys start comparing your subs to your friends subs, you gotta make the playing field even. if they are different cars, the game is over before it starts. if its the same car then you need to have the same amp too. our cars have the ability to really pound when you face those subs toward the rear hatch glass. remember the above when comparing subs.

Cerwin Vega, Vega Series

this is my choice pick.they sounds great,look good.



Woofer
12"

Nominal Impedance
4 ohms
4 ohms/voice coil VEGA 12D4

Sensitivity
94 dB*

Power Handling
400W (rms)
200W/voice coil VEGA 12D4 (rms)
800W (max)

Frequency Response
20-500 Hz
